1. What is Nandrolone?
Nandrolone, chemically known as 19-nortestosterone, is an anabolic steroid derived from testosterone. It is known for promoting muscle growth and increasing bone density, making it favorable for athletes and bodybuilders aiming to enhance their performance.
2. Benefits of Nandrolone
- Increased Muscle Mass: Nandrolone aids in muscle protein synthesis, leading to significant muscle growth.
- Enhanced Recovery: It can improve recovery times after intense workouts, allowing for more frequent training sessions.
- Bone Health: Nandrolone has been shown to positively impact bone density, which is particularly beneficial for those at risk of osteoporosis.
- Reduces Fat Tissue: It may help decrease body fat while simultaneously increasing lean muscle mass.
3. Risks and Side Effects
Despite its benefits, nandrolone use comes with potential risks:
- Hormonal Imbalances: Nandrolone can disrupt the body’s natural testosterone production, leading to hormonal issues.
- Cardiovascular Problems: Long-term use may increase the risk of heart disease due to alterations in cholesterol levels.
- Liver Damage: Although nandrolone is less hepatotoxic compared to other steroids, misuse can still lead to liver complications.
- Psychological Effects: Users may experience mood swings, aggression, or depression when discontinuing use.
